Times Microwave Systems Logo

Times Microwave Systems

Locations: 358 Hall Ave Wallingford, Connecticut 06492, US + (+4 more)

Company Size: 200 - 300

Industry: Appliances, Electrical, and Electronics Manufacturing

Company Website

AI Description

drawer
    No team member to display There are currently no team member available.